Exercise Classes

All classes are specially designed for the over 50s. 
All levels & abilities are welcome and all classes provide full adaptability and modifications for health conditions, disabilities and beginners.

Cardio Classes

Circuits

A circuit style class with individual cardio and weighted exercise stations. Each exercise is performed for a short period of time before moving around the room to complete the full circle. 

Quick Burn

A 30 minute express cardio class designed for burning calories and keeping your heart
and lungs healthy.

Weight Loss Bootcamp

This is a beginner class and is a one way ticket to dropping the pounds. Primarily a cardio class, with a short weighted section designed to lose weight and tone up.

Strength

Beginners Weight Training

Learn the fundamental principles of weight training, techniques of exercises and how to maximise the many benefits of weight training in a safe, beginner friendly environment.

Pump & Tone

This exercise class is for all levels, involving light weights and high repetitions to tone the body.

Legs, Bums & Tums

Specifically designed to tone up your core and lower body, it is a combination of resistance training exercises targeting
legs, glutes and core to tighten
up those abs!

Senior Strength

Mandatory gym introduction with the fitness coordinator including a medical health questionnaire and discussion about your health and fitness related goals, demonstration on how to use the fitness equipment properly and the offer of a custom written exercise programme.

Mind & Body

Pilates

A fun and focused Pilates class for intermediate level, ideal for developing a strong core and improving overall flexibility, muscle strength, co-ordination and balance.

Seated Yoga

A gentle yoga where postures are practiced while seated or with the aid of a chair.

Qigong

The grandmother of Tai Chi, this is a gentle form of exercise incorporating movement, breath work and self massage. Good for improving circulation, flexibility, balance and stress levels.

Beginners Pilates

A contemporary, fun and focused Pilates class. It is multi-level and fantastic for developing a strong core and improving overall flexibility, muscle strength, co-ordination and balance.

Traditional Yoga

A gentle yoga focusing on slow, steady movements. Enjoy stretching the body and finding stillness of mind.

Dance

Zumba Gold

Feel empowered and have fun with easy to follow Zumba choreography at a lower intensity.

Super Six

Healthy Joints

A specific fitness class designed around the national guidelines for Osteoarthritis, Rheumatoid arthritis and Osteoporosis. 

Movement for the Mind

A specific fitness class designed around the national guidelines for mild to moderate Depression and Anxiety.

Breath Better

A specific fitness class designed around the national guidelines for mild COPD and mild to moderate Asthma.

Chair Based Exercise

A seated fitness class with a variety of exercises including flexibility, muscle strengthening and heart and lung function.

Slow & Steady Mobility

The next step up from a chair based class providing an evenly balanced and easy to perform standing workout. Involving cardio, mobility, strength and flexibility at a slower and steadier pace.

Fit with Diabetes

A specific fitness class designed around the national guidelines for Diabetes Type 1 and 2.
